Derek Kan, the under secretary for transportation policy at the U.S. Department of Transportation, visited Pittsburgh Friday to consider technology, policy and infrastructure in a city that paved the way for autonomous vehicles.
Kan participated in two roundtable discussions and toured the local offices of Uber Technologies Inc. and Argo AI. He said the conversations with officials from some of Pittsburgh’s autonomous vehicle companies, as well as universities, focused on how to regulate autonomous vehicles.
He also emphasized that the need to continue developing those policies is imminent.
“It’s not when self-driving cars are 100 percent of the cars on the road or when it’s zero percent,” Kan said. “It’s going to be when it’s 5 percent of the cars on the road, and we are starting to see that.”
